The University of Texas MD Anderson Cancer Center is seeking a Senior Cybersecurity Analyst Security Operations Center to serve within the Cybersecurity department, supporting the Security Operations Center (SOC). The Senior Cybersecurity Analyst Security Operations Center is responsible for continuous monitoring, detection, analysis, and response to cybersecurity threats and incidents across the institution, operating as a key Tier 2 escalation resource. This role plays a critical function in bridging frontline triage with advanced forensic investigation while strengthening enterprise detection capabilities.
UT MD Anderson is a leading institution focused on cancer care, research, education, and prevention. The Senior Cybersecurity Analyst Security Operations Center contributes directly to protecting critical systems, data, and operations that enable lifesaving work. As part of a highly specialized SOC team, the Senior Cybersecurity Analyst Security Operations Center ensures the organization maintains a strong, proactive cybersecurity posture.
The ideal candidate brings advanced SOC experience with strong hands-on expertise in SIEM platforms, threat detection, and incident response, along with a bachelor's degree in a relevant field (master's preferred). They demonstrate leadership in handling complex security incidents, possess relevant industry certifications such as GCIA, GCIH, GCFA, CySA , Security , or CISSP, and have experience operating within enterprise environments while mentoring junior analysts.

Responsibilities
Security Monitoring & Threat Detection
Lead continuous monitoring of the institutional environment using SIEM and detection platforms
Develop, tune, and maintain correlation rules, detection use cases, and alerting content
Identify malicious or anomalous activity through advanced threat detection techniques
Incident Response & Triage
Lead response to escalated Tier 1 alerts and security incidents
Investigate root causes and determine scope and impact of incidents
Manage containment and eradication procedures to resolve threats
Threat Hunting & Intelligence Integration
Proactively hunt for hidden threats and anomalous activity across systems
Operationalize threat intelligence including indicators of compromise and adversary TTPs
Map observed activity to the MITRE ATT&CK framework to enhance detection and response
Detection Engineering, AI & Automation
Develop and maintain detection logic, use cases, and automated response playbooks
Minimize false positives through continuous tuning and optimization
Leverage AI technologies, including generative and agentic capabilities, to improve SOC performance
Support development and implementation of AI agents integrated with security tools and MCP
Technical Leadership, Metrics & Documentation
Serve as a technical lead and escalation point for SOC analysts
Mentor junior and mid-level analysts and lead knowledge transfer activities
Develop SOC metrics, dashboards, and reports on performance and threat trends
Maintain SOC workflows, runbooks, and standard operating procedures
Support escalation of complex incidents to Tier 3 or CSIRT teams
